Button 贝宝按钮和网站预订

Button 贝宝按钮和网站预订,button,paypal,Button,Paypal,在我的应用程序中,我计划使用PayPal的BuyNow按钮来售票 我的计划是 当用户选择要购买的票证时,创建一个预订标记,表明已购买1张票证 给这个预约一个生存的时间,比如说15分钟。如果用户没有购买,我将自动关闭预订,机票库存将增加 用户点击pay now buton,发送到pay pal。假设这需要30分钟 用户完成事务 贝宝回我的网站 然而,在这一点上,我会关闭预订,他们会支付,但我没有他们的票 我如何处理这种模式 使用PayPal的“立即购买”按钮,您总是会遇到这个问题,因为付款本身发生

在我的应用程序中,我计划使用PayPal的BuyNow按钮来售票

我的计划是

  • 当用户选择要购买的票证时,创建一个预订标记,表明已购买1张票证
  • 给这个预约一个生存的时间,比如说15分钟。如果用户没有购买,我将自动关闭预订,机票库存将增加
  • 用户点击pay now buton,发送到pay pal。假设这需要30分钟
  • 用户完成事务
  • 贝宝回我的网站
  • 然而,在这一点上,我会关闭预订,他们会支付,但我没有他们的票


    我如何处理这种模式

    使用PayPal的“立即购买”按钮,您总是会遇到这个问题,因为付款本身发生在PayPal网站上,您不知道确切的时间

    在您的情况下,最好使用快速结账,付款过程的最后一步将发生在您的网站上。这意味着您可以在付款之前验证是否有可能的预订

    如果从下图查看流程,可以在调用DoExpressCheckoutPayment之前验证预订是否打开:


    您可以通过多种方式与贝宝建立联系,这是一个即将在这里投票表决的问题。如果你想的话,我很乐意帮你找出最好的方法来完成这件事。